    Meet The Producer

    Meet The Wine Producer Behind The Bottle

    A brief look at the producer’s heritage and winemaking approach.

    Vito Curatolo Arini

    Vito Curatolo Arini is one of Sicily’s historic family-owned wine producers, founded in 1875 in Marsala, western Sicily. Established by Vito Curatolo, the winery built its reputation on producing traditional Sicilian wines, particularly the island’s famous Marsala, while preserving the family’s deep connection to the land and local winemaking heritage.

    For more than five generations, the Curatolo Arini family has remained dedicated to showcasing the character of Sicily through authentic wines made from indigenous grape varieties. The estate’s long experience with fortified wines has helped maintain the traditions of Marsala production while allowing the winery to evolve with modern tastes and techniques.

    Today, Vito Curatolo Arini continues to represent the heritage of Sicilian winemaking, combining generations of knowledge with a passion for producing wines that reflect the island’s history, climate and unique identity.

    FAQs For Vito Curatolo Arini 10 Year Old Marsala Superiore Riserva

    How is this wine made?

    Traditional Sicilian grapes; Grillo, Inzolia and Catarratto are fortified with white grape spirit and enriched with mistella and must. The wine is then matured for 10 years in a combination of Slavonian oak casks, French barriques and American tonneaux.

    This long ageing process develops complexity, richness and aromatic depth, resulting in a wine that reflects both heritage and craftsmanship from Sicily’s oldest family‑owned Marsala producer.

    What does Superiore Riserva mean in Marsala wine?

    It is a Marsala classification that indicates a wine with extended ageing and greater complexity.

    Is Marsala only used for cooking?

    No. While Marsala is well known as a cooking ingredient, premium examples such as Vito Curatolo Arini Superiore Riserva are designed for drinking. Its complexity makes it suitable as an aperitif, digestif or dessert wine.

    What is mistella in Marsala wine production?

    Mistella is a traditional component used in some Marsala wines, made by combining grape must with spirit to preserve sweetness and add richness. It contributes to the balance and depth of the finished wine.
